>> The WiX Toolset cannot be used to install software on non-Windows systems.
>>
>> My current understanding is the WiX Toolset depends on .NET Framework
>> v2.0 which does not support non-Windows hosts. Additionally, the WiX
>> Toolset depends on Win32 APIs via pInvoke to produce MSIs which are not
>> generally available on non-Windows systems. These requirements currently
>> stop the WiX Toolset to be used on non-Windows systems to create installers
>> for Windows.
